The Influence of Emotions on Betting Choices
Emotions play a significant role in sports betting decisions. Anticipation and excitement frequently lead bettors to make impulsive decisions without considering every angle. This can result in hasty bets made out of passionate reactions rather than calculated analysis.
The Impact of Cognitive Biases
Cognitive biases, such as confirmation bias and optimism bias, can cloud judgment and lead to illogical betting decisions. Bettors tend to seek information that confirms their pre-existing beliefs (regardless of whether they are accurate) and exaggerate the likelihood of positive outcomes, disregarding potential risks.
In the world of sports betting, it's crucial to remain objective and avoid letting emotions cloud your judgment.
The Role of Social Influence
Social influence plays a significant role in sports betting behavior. People tend to follow the crowd, especially when they see others making wagers on a certain team or outcome. This herd mentality can lead to groupthink, where individual judgment is influenced by the actions of others rather than independent analysis.
Understanding Risk Perception
Perception of risk varies among individuals and can significantly impact sports betting decisions. Some bettors are risk-averse and prefer more secure bets with lower potential returns, while others are risk-takers who are drawn to high-risk, high-reward opportunities. Understanding your own risk perception is vital in making informed betting choices.
Strategies for Responsible Betting
While the psychology behind sports betting decisions can be complex, there are strategies that can help bettors make more rational choices. Setting specific betting limits, avoiding chasing losses, and conducting thorough research before placing bets are essential practices for responsible betting.
- Determine a budget and stick to it.
- Avoid emotional betting based on recent outcomes.
- Familiarize yourself about the sports you are betting on.
- Take into account the odds and potential risks before placing a bet.
